To launch a map or mod, click Tools from the menu bar of the application and click the map from the list that appears under Launch Maps.Originally posted by tonyalbera80:I will stick to BO3. The UGX Map Manager will automatically install the map's files for you. A loading bar will indicate the download's progress and show the download speed in kb/s.Īfter a map finishes downloading, you need not do anything more. Once you select a map to download from the left column, press the Download Map button on the right side of the screen. If you would like to see all available maps, regardless of what version you have, press the Show all Maps button in the bottom left corner of the app. Once you open the app, on the left side you will see a list of available UGX maps that you do not already have the latest version of.
